Gun found in Colorado elementary school student’s backpack; lockdown lifted

It was a scary morning for some parents and students when staff at Arrowhead Elementary School in Aurora found a loaded gun in a student’s backpack.

The Aurora Police Department said the student was contacted after they received a report of a student with a firearm just before 8:30 a.m. That gun was secured by responding officers.
